Description
The APD 41391 accepts a thermocouple temperature input and
provides one DC process output and one thermocouple output.
This makes it useful to match up the available thermocouple
type with an instrument input type, for data recording, or when
isolating the input.
The thermocouple input type and temperature range are fac-
tory set. The DC output type and range, and the thermocouple
output type and range are factory set. The DC output and the
thermocouple output correspond to the input temperature

Full 4-way galvanic isolation (input 1, output 1, output 2,
power) make this module useful for ground loop elimination,
common mode signal rejection, and noise pickup reduction.
LoopTracker
An API exclusive feature includes a green LoopTracker LED that
varies in intensity with changes in the input signal and a red
LoopTracker LED that varies in intensity with changes in the
channel 1 DC output signal. It provides a quick visual picture
of your process at all times and can greatly aid in saving time
during initial startup and troubleshooting.
Output Push-to-Test
An API exclusive feature includes an output test switch to pro-
vide a fixed output for the DC output channel (independent of
the input) when pressed. The output test greatly aids in saving
time during initial startup and/or troubleshooting.
The output test level is factory set to approximately 75% of
span but a custom test level may be ordered.
